Milestones Over Two Decades

From our beginnings in 2006 to today, these milestones reflect how access through golf has grown into opportunity and lasting impact for young people.
5mm Rounds Malaya and Tisha-1-1
Hit 5 Million Rounds

Youth on Course surpassed five million rounds played, with the milestone round recorded by Maryland native Malaya Johnson, reflecting the impact of affordable access for youth nationwide.

Partnership with Bank of America

Youth on Course partnered with Bank of America to launch Golf with Us, expanding free memberships and affordable access to play for youth across the country.

Hit 4 Million Rounds

In under one year Youth on Course members hit another 1 million rounds, bringing the total since 2006 to 4 million rounds played by members for $5 or less.

Expand to Australia

Youth on Course partnered with Golf Australia and TeeMates to provide youth access on another continent.

$1M Raised from GolfNow

Through our partnership with NBC SportsNext, Youth on Course received a check from Rory McIlroy, co-founder of GolfNow, after generous golfers raised $1M when booking a round of golf.

Launched DRIVE Club

In partnership with TaylorMade, Youth on Course launched the DRIVE Club providing members the opportunity to mentor and introduce young people to the sport.

Launched Careers on Course

Careers on Course launched to provide members with access to internship opportunities.

Launched Youth on Course

Youth on Course launched in Northern California with six courses starting with Poppy Hills Golf Course.
